What We Did
We developed this design to balance operational efficiency with resident comfort. The skewed K-Plan creates an inviting open plan lobby area, as well as extra room for courtyards between wings, providing spacious living areas and a large courtyard with a walking path, benches, and a pergola. We positioned the central nurse station for line of sight visual control of the entire building, including through the Dayroom into the wider courtyard, enhancing staff efficiency and resident safety. To break up typical long hallways, we widened corridors to allow for furniture placement. Multiple relaxation options for residents include Dayrooms, an Activity area, a library, and a covered Patio overlooking the courtyard. The Physical Therapy area serves both residents and outpatients, offering Physical, Speech, and Occupational Therapy services.
